A proposed 10-storey serviced apartment development by Multi Majestic Sdn. Bhd. at Sungai Bakap. Located along Jalan Sentosa, just a stone’s throw away from Sungai Bakai Hospital. It is only 20 minutes drive away from Penang Second Bridge via North-South Expressway through Jawi interchange.

This is probably going to be one the first serviced apartment at Sungai Bakap, offering 24 residential units with facilities.

The project is still pending for approval. More details to be available upon project launch.

Proposed Penang Sky Cab still in the works

Property News/ 18 August 2018 12 comments

penangskycab

The proposed Penang Sky Cab project is still in the works, said Penang Chief Minister Chow Kon Yeow.

Chow said Penang Sentral has already obtained approval for its detailed environment impact assessment (DEIA).

“The project is not scrapped. It is still very active. The ports of landing may be adjusted and the alignment will be changed,” he told reporters after a site visit to Penang Sentral on Tuesday.

The Penang lawmaker said the alignment may be changed so that it is closer to the inner city of George Town.

The Penang Sky Cab project is a 3km cable car system that will traverse the channel between the island and the mainland.

Undertaken by Penang Sentral Sdn Bhd, which is under the Malaysian Resources Corporation Berhad (MRCB), the project was first announced in 2015.

Penang Sentral reportedly obtained approval from the Department of Environment for its DEIA in 2016.

The first phase was initially expected to be completed this year but work has yet to commence on the project.

The cable car system will connect Penang Sentral in Butterworth with George Town on the island.

The first phase of the project will have 40 cabins capable of transporting about 1,000 passengers both ways per hour.

BNM to roll out special housing loan next month

Property News/ 15 August 2018 1 comment

bnmBank Negara Malaysia (BNM) is expected to roll out a special housing loan scheme tailored for the low-to-middle income group with regard to first-home ownership by next month, according to the ministry of finance (MoF).

“BNM is in the process of finalising a new financing scheme for the purchase of first homes for the low-to-middle income group with several pioneer banks, Cagamas Bhd and the housing and local government ministry,” the ministry said in a written reply to a parliamentary question by member of parliament for Padang Besar Datuk Zahidi Zainul Abidin, who asked about the government’s strategy to help people obtain bank loans for affordable housing and first-home financing for youth in view of BNM’s strict conditions and procedures.

The features of the scheme include giving flexibility to banks in lending guidelines for first-home buyers, requiring first-home buyers to attend financial counselling to ensure they receive adequate financial advice before taking a housing loan, and reducing the overall cost of first-home ownership such as stamp duty and insurance.

The ministry said for the time being, homebuyers who intend to purchase their first home can access the schemes offered by financial institutions in collaboration with the government such as My First Home Scheme, Skim Jaminan Kredit Perumahan, Skim Pembiayaan Fleksibel PR1MA and Skim Sewa-Beli Hartanah.

UPCOMING: Bayan Baru / Ideal Property Group

Bayan Baru/ 14 August 2018 2 comments

proposed-development-gvc-property

A proposed mixed development by GVC Property Sdn. Bhd. (Ideal Property Group) at Bayan Baru. Strategically located along Persiaran Bayan, adjacent to SK Sungai Ara and SJKC Chong Cheng. It is about 1km to Setia SPICE Arena, under 5 minutes drive to Penang International Airport.

This development comprises a mix of residential and commercial components in 4 parcels:

Parcel 1:

  • 39-storey condominium (389 units)
  • Shop office (23 units)

Parcel 2:

  • 6-storey building with shop offices, hawker stalls and multipurpose hall

Parcel 3:

  • 3-storey office block

Parcel 4:

  • Future development (Football field)

This is still pending for approval. More details to be available upon project launch.
